Tricyclic Antidepressants

The following is a list of drugs that *some*  plastic surgeons do not want their patients taking prior to breast augmentation surgery.  If a medication that you are currently taking, or  are planning to take, is listed, please consult with your plastic surgeon .  You will need to follow his or her advice regarding any medications and/or vitamin/herbal supplements you are using.

 

Adapin
Amitriptyline
Amoxapine
Anafranil
Asendin
Aventyl

Clomipramine

Desipramine
Doxepin

Elavil
Endep
Etrafon products

Imipramine

Janimine

Limbitrol products
Ludiomil

Maprotiline

Norpramin
Nortriptyline

Pamelor
Petrofrane
Protriptyline

Sinequan
Surmontil

Tofranil
Triavil
Trimipramine

Vivactil
